It lies at the junction of the Talas River and the Turk-Sib Railway. Auliye-Ata is one of the oldest towns of Kazakstan. It stands on the site of the ancient city of Taraz, which flourished as a stop along the Silk Road until it was destroyed by Mongol armies in the 13th century. Calcareous sponges occur mainly on the rocky bottoms of the continental shelves in temperate, shallow waters; they are usually dull in colour. Most are small, seldom exceeding 15 cm (6 inches).&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11188236-112078380952628873?l=waitingfeather.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/feeds/112078380952628873/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11188236&amp;postID=112078380952628873'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/112078380952628873'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/112078380952628873'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/2005/07/calcareous-sponge.html' title='&lt;a href=&apos;http://www.makeup-accessories.com&apos; title=&apos;lipstick, makeup, cosmetics, mascara, foundation, makeup bags&apos;&gt;Calcareous Sponge&lt;/a&gt;'/><author><name>WaitingFeather</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/08541085283740178096</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11188236.post-112062601029861253</id><published>2005-07-06T01:00: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2005-07-05T22:00:10.306-07:00</updated><title type='text'>Cinna, Lucius Cornelius</title><content type='html'>After serving in the Social War (90&amp;#150;88), Cinna became consul in 87. Uijongbu lies 12 miles (20 km) north of Seoul. Its name, meaning &amp;#147;the Cabinet&amp;#148; in old Korean, derives from its being the temporary site of the Cabinet office during the Choson (Yi) dynasty (1392&amp;#150;1910). The city was formerly the market centre for agricultural products grown in the surrounding area. Chrysotile, the fibrous form of the mineral serpentine, is the best-known type and accounts for about 95 percent of all asbestos in commercial use. It is a hydrous magnesium silicate with the chemical composition of Mg3Si2O5(OH)4. After the Peace of&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11188236-111019691639425996?l=waitingfeather.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/feeds/111019691639425996/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11188236&amp;postID=111019691639425996'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019691639425996'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019691639425996'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/2005/02/la-noue-franois-de.html' title='La Noue, Fran�ois De'/><author><name>WaitingFeather</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/08541085283740178096</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11188236.post-111019691682177963</id><published>2005-02-25T11:08: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-03-07T04:01:56.823-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Amphibole</title><content type='html'>The fundamental building block of all silicate mineral structures is the silicon-oxygen tetrahedron (SiO4)4-. It consists of a central silicon atom surrounded by four oxygen atoms in the shape of a tetrahedron. Located on the Conakry-Kankan railway and at the intersection of roads from Kindia, Dalaba, Dabola, and Faranah, Mamou was founded in 1908 as a collecting point on the railroad from Conakry (125 miles [201 km] southwest). It is the chief trading centre for the rice, cattle, citrus fruits, bananas, tomatoes, and mangoes raised in the surrounding agricultural area.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11188236-111019691936090315?l=waitingfeather.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/feeds/111019691936090315/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11188236&amp;postID=111019691936090315'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019691936090315'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019691936090315'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/2005/02/mamou.html' title='Mamou'/><author><name>WaitingFeather</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/08541085283740178096</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11188236.post-110994077605525125</id><published>2005-02-19T10:26: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-03-04T04:52:56.056-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Ascaris, The rise of the major sects: Vaishnavism, Saivism, and Saktism</title><content type='html'>any of a genus of worms (order Ascaridida, class Nematoda) that are parasitic in the intestines of various terrestrial animals, chiefly herbivores. The Maban languages form a branch of the Nilo-Saharan language family. Maba (also called Bura Mabang) is the largest Maban language in terms of number of speakers (more than 250,000). Other members of the group include Karanga, Kibet, Massalat, Masalit (Massalit), Marfa, and Runga.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11188236-111019692276269339?l=waitingfeather.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/feeds/111019692276269339/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11188236&amp;postID=111019692276269339'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019692276269339'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019692276269339'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/2005/02/maban-languages.html' title='Maban Languages'/><author><name>WaitingFeather</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/08541085283740178096</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11188236.post-110994078006019587</id><published>2005-02-10T06:41: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-03-04T04:53:00.063-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Ascites, The rise of the major sects: Vaishnavism, Saivism, and Saktism</title><content type='html'>accumulation of fluid in the peritoneal cavity, between the membrane lining the abdominal wall and the membrane covering the abdominal organs. In the first half of the century it was Arras that particularly prospered under the patronage of the dukes of Burgundy. Duke Philip the Good (1396 - 1467) had a specially designed building erected in the city to allow for better conservation of his tapestry collection.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11188236-111019692447083537?l=waitingfeather.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/feeds/111019692447083537/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11188236&amp;postID=111019692447083537'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019692447083537'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019692447083537'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/2005/02/tapestry-15th-century.html' title='Tapestry, 15th century'/><author><name>WaitingFeather</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/08541085283740178096</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11188236.post-110994078099313060</id><published>2005-02-08T09:34: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-03-04T04:53:00.993-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Asclepiades Of Bithynia, The rise of the major sects: Vaishnavism, Saivism, and Saktism</title><content type='html'>He opposed the humoral doctrine of Hippocrates and instead taught that disease results from constricted or relaxed conditions of the solid particles, a doctrine derived from the atomic&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11188236-110994078099313060?l=waitingfeather.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/feeds/110994078099313060/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11188236&amp;postID=110994078099313060'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/110994078099313060'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/110994078099313060'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/2005/02/asclepiades-of-bithynia-rise-of-major.html' title='Asclepiades Of Bithynia, The rise of the major sects: Vaishnavism, Saivism, and Saktism'/><author><name>WaitingFeather</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/08541085283740178096</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11188236.post-111019692487411646</id><published>2005-02-07T16:48: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-03-07T04:02:04.876-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Norbert Of Xanten, Saint</title><content type='html'>Norbert was ordained in 1115. Ronald Taylor, Richard Wagner: The Life, Art and Thought (1979), emphasizes the historical background of his life; Charles Osborne, Wagner and His World (1977), is a brief introductory biography. Important sources include The Diary of Richard Wagner, ed. by Joachim Bergfeld (1980); Cosima Wagner's Diaries, ed. by Martin Gregor-Dellin and Dietrich Mack (1978 -  ); and Wagner's Mein Leben, 2 vol. (1870 - 81; Eng. trans., My Life, 1911). See also the official German and English biographies by C.F. Glasenapp, Das Leben Richard Wagners, 6 vol. (1894 - 1911); and W.A. Ellis, Life of Richard Wagner, 6 vol. (1900 - 08). Robert W. Gutman, Richard Wagner: The Man, His Mind and His Music (1968), is a largely hostile biography. An analytical introduction to Wagner's music dramas is Ernest Newman, The Wagner Operas (1949; republished with the title Wagner Nights, 1950). A detailed study of Wagner's development as a musical dramatist is Jack M. Stein, Richard Wagner and the Synthesis of the Arts (1960). A.O. Lorenz, Das Geheimnis der Form bei Richard Wagner, 4 vol. (1924 - 33), provides an exhaustive bar-by-bar analysis of the musical construction of his major works. George Bernard Shaw, The Perfect Wagnerite, 4th ed. (1922, reprinted 1967), which has much of value to say about the social, political, and economic ideas behind The Ring; Jungian interpretation of the same work is Robert Donington, Wagner's Ring and Its Symbols, 2nd ed. (1969).&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11188236-111019692578074060?l=waitingfeather.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/feeds/111019692578074060/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11188236&amp;postID=111019692578074060'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019692578074060'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019692578074060'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/2005/02/wagner-richard.html' title='Wagner, Richard'/><author><name>WaitingFeather</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/08541085283740178096</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11188236.post-110994078232531674</id><published>2005-02-05T06:42: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-03-04T04:53:02.326-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Ascoli, Graziadio Isaia, The rise of the major sects: Vaishnavism, Saivism, and Saktism</title><content type='html'>Ascoli did not receive any formal higher education, but he wrote his first major work, on Oriental languages, in 1854. Walker et al., Mammals of the World, 3 vol. (1964), in which each genus is described and illustrated, along with a brief summation of its biology. The taxonomy of carnivores is discussed in G.G. Simpson, �Principles of Classification and a Classification of Mammals,� Bull. Am. Mus. Nat. Hist., vol. 85 (1945), a classic work on classification, followed by most recent mammalogists; and H.J. Stains, �Carnivores and Pinnipeds,� in S. Anderson and J.K. Jones, Jr. (eds.), Recent Mammals of the World: A Synopsis of Families (1967). F.E. Beddard, Mammalia (1902, reprinted 1958), is a definitive early work on mammalian anatomy. The paleontology of the Carnivora is summarized in two works by A.S. Romer: Vertebrate Paleontology, 3rd ed. (1966), fundamental to an understanding of fossil forms, and Notes and Comments on Vertebrate Paleontology (1968), containing additional information not found in the general text. Books devoted to particular subgroups of the carnivores include A. Denis, Cats of the World (1964), an excellent summary of the status of all members of the Felidae; C.J. Harris, Otters (1968), a fine summary of the status of the otters around the world; H.E. Hinton and A.M.S. Dunn, Mongooses: Their Natural History and Behaviour (1967), which contains much interesting information that is difficult to find elsewhere, except in scattered literature; R.J. Harrison et al. (eds.), The Behavior and Physiology of Pinnipeds (1968), an excellent summation of knowledge on these aquatic carnivores; and V.B. Scheffer, Seals, Sea Lions, and Walruses: A Review of the Pinnipedia (1958), a major work on the taxonomy of the Pinnipedia.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/11188236-111019692951372927?l=waitingfeather.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/feeds/111019692951372927/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=11188236&amp;postID=111019692951372927'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019692951372927'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/11188236/posts/default/111019692951372927'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://waitingfeather.blogspot.com/2005/01/carnivore.html' title='Carnivore'/><author><name>WaitingFeather</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/08541085283740178096</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='16' height='16' src='http://img2.blogblog.com/img/b16-rounded.gif'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-11188236.post-110994078671584650</id><published>2005-01-27T00:09: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-03-04T04:53:06.716-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Ash Wednesday, The rise of the major sects: Vaishnavism, Saivism, and Saktism</title><content type='html'>in the Christian church, the first day of Lent, occurring 6  1/2 weeks before Easter (between February 4 and March 11, depending on the date of Easter).
